2016-03-16 39 views
6

我已經成功構建了node.js插件,它可以在Windows上適用於Node。 現在,我想創建一個使用Electron的Windows應用程序。當加載在HTML文件中的模塊,我得到了錯誤:電子未捕獲錯誤:動態鏈接庫(DLL)初始化例程失敗

var dbr = require('./build/Release/dbr'); 

enter image description here

蹊蹺ATOM_SHELL_ASAR.jsenter image description here

該問題僅在Windows上發生。在Linux和Mac上,它運行良好。

我該如何解決?

謝謝!

回答

8

您需要重建Electron的本地Node插件,the steps are outlined in the docs

+0

對於Windows?它在Linux上工作,無需重建。 – yushulx

+0

它也適用於Mac OS X,無需重建。 – yushulx

+0

我已經重建了Windows的模塊,現在它正在工作。你能否解釋爲什麼我不需要重建Linux和Mac的模塊?謝謝。 – yushulx

相關問題